The National Telecommunications Commission (NTC) has recorded over 14 million Subscriber Identity Module (SIM) card registrants more than a week after the mandatory registration began.

Based on the latest tally issued by the NTC, Smart Communications Inc. still has the highest number of registrants so far with a total of 7,206,528. It was followed by Globe Telecom with 6,388,232, and Dito Telecommunity with 1,263,407 registered subscribers.SIM card Under the Republic Act No. 11934 or the SIM Registration Act, all new and existing users shall register their SIMs within 180 days beginning Dec. 27. Failure to comply with this mandatory registration will result in the deactivation of a user’s SIM.

In relation to this, the Department of Information and Communications Technology urged the public to register their SIMs early to avoid “any inconvenience” due to the tight deadline implemented.
